About John Long

John Long is a scholar working on Social Psychology, Human-Computer Interaction, Artificial Intelligence, Cognitive Neuroscience and Developmental and Educational Psychology, having authored 83 papers that have together received 2.9k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Human-Automation Interaction and Safety (18 papers), Usability and User Interface Design (15 papers), Business Process Modeling and Analysis (6 papers), Ergonomics and Human Factors (5 papers), Visual perception and processing mechanisms (4 papers), Design Education and Practice (4 papers), Speech and dialogue systems (4 papers) and Technology Adoption and User Behaviour (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Cognitive Neuroscience (1.7k citations), Human-Computer Interaction (438 citations), Experimental and Cognitive Psychology (550 citations), Developmental and Educational Psychology (394 citations) and Social Psychology (586 citations). John Long has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, United States and Canada. Frequent co-authors include Bruce O. Bergum, Alan Baddeley, J.D. Dowell, Andy Whitefield, Philip Barnard, Ian A. Clark, John Morton, Edward L. Wike, Ν. G. L. Hammond and Nick V. Hammond.
